How To Fix MG255 - Transaction &: no country for sales org. could be found


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: MG - Batch input: material master

  • Message number: 255

  • Message text: Transaction &: no country for sales org. could be found

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    This sales organization has no table entry for country.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message MG255 - Transaction &: no country for sales org. could be found ?

    The SAP error message MG255 ("Transaction &: no country for sales org. could be found") typically occurs when there is an issue with the configuration of the sales organization in the SAP system. This error indicates that the system cannot find a valid country assignment for the specified sales organization.

    Causes:

    1. Missing Country Assignment: The sales organization is not assigned to a country in the configuration settings.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for the sales organization may be incomplete or incorrect.
    3.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the master data related to the sales organization, such as missing or incorrect entries in the relevant tables.
    4. Transport Issues: If the configuration was recently transported from another system, there may have been issues during the transport process.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Sales Organization Configuration:

      • Go to the transaction code OVX5 (or SPRO -> Sales and Distribution -> Master Data -> Business Partners -> Define Sales Organization).
      • Ensure that the sales organization is correctly assigned to a country.
    2. Maintain Country Assignment:

      • If the sales organization is missing a country assignment, you can add it by navigating to the relevant configuration area and assigning the appropriate country to the sales organization.
    3. Verify Master Data:

      • Check the master data for the sales organization, including customer master records and material master records, to ensure that all necessary data is correctly maintained.
    4. Transport Request Check:

      • If the issue arose after a transport, check the transport logs for any errors or warnings that may indicate problems with the configuration.
